Details

The City of Hamilton is preparing to host the 4th annual City Food Festival from 16th to 21st of March.

Sample from some of Bermuda’s finest dining establishment, watch local chefs to compete in a canapé competition, and a day of cultural food delights in a festive atmosphere for both families and the distinguished food lovers alike. Tickets are avaliable online at www.ptix.bm.

Chef Competition

March 16th & 18th - 5:30 - 8:30pm - Bermuda Gas, 25 Serpentine Road, Pembroke

The Chef Competition kicks off the week of events with two preliminary rounds taking place on March 16th and 18th at Bermuda Gas. Each chef’s name will be randomly drawn from a box for night selection, with a maximum of five chefs participating per night. The winner from each night will advance to the finals taking place at the Street Festival on March 21st. All Chefs will be tasked with preparing three distinctly different canapés from a box of ingredients. The list of ingredients will be provided to the chefs five (5) days prior and the actual ingredients will be provided 48 hours in advance. This is a ticketed event.

Tickets: $35.00 per event or you can buy a passport for $60.00 for entry to both (March 16 & 18). Ticket holders will have the opportunity to sample the chef’s creations while enjoying complimentary signature beverages provided by Goslings, additional hors d’oeuvres and entry into a raffle draw for great prizes.

Goslings Wine Tasting

March 20th - 5:30- 7:30pm - Gosling’s Wine Cellar, 9 Dundonald Street, Hamilton

Wines are quite complex and exhibit various characteristics which change according to the glassware they are served in. Join us as we explore a variety of red and white wines while learning and understanding wine tasting notes.

Tickets: $100 which includes a four piece Riedel stemware set.

City Food Festival

March 21st - 3:00 - 9:00pm – City Hall Car Park

Participating in the street festival is a cross section of restaurants, caterers, and food-related companies to create an unforgettable food tasting experience. The City Food Festival takes place in City Hall Car Park on March 21, 2015. More than a two dozen restaurants and bars island wide will be featured, offering a wide variety of foods and specialty drinks. There will be multiple food demonstrations, fun-filled food competitions for the public to participate in, as well as the City Food Festival Chef Competition finals taking place live at the event. Come out and explore samplings of some of Bermuda’s finest restaurants and bars as they showcase their skills. We are looking forward to an exciting day of activities and we encourage residents and visitors alike to come out and EXPERIENCE the City Food Festival.

Tickets: $40.00 (Booklet for 8 food and 2 drinks tickets) Great Value; $5 for single tickets.
